The Connection Between Vision and Comfort in Contact Lens

When a patient comes in and says that their eyes are uncomfortable at the end of the day with their contact lenses, we often think that must mean the lens is dry. But discomfort to a patient can be as driven by eye strain due to a vision clarity issue as it is by dryness or lens awareness. On this podcast episode, we discuss deciphering the patient contact lens experience with Dr. Erin Rueff, Chief of the Cornea and Contact Lens department at the Marshall B. Ketchum University Eye Center.

Contact Lens Institute Shares Additional Findings Ahead of May 3rd Webinars

and practice growth—through contact lens fitting. Among all adults ages 55+, 67% use prescription glasses and 38% use reading glasses, but only 6% wear contact lenses. In the same age group, only 4% recall their eye care practitioner having discussed contact lenses as a potential alternative to readers during their last two office visits.

Optometry Podcast: Talking to Parents About Myopia Management

Dr. Tsang, Dr. Kwan, and Dr. Lyerly all share that a great approach is to talk to parents about the young patients in the practice that have been successful wearing contact lenses. CooperVision has also created great video content on the MiSight® YouTube channel  featuring real patients sharing their contact lens insertion and removal tips. These videos are a useful tool to share with parents so they can see kids as young as 8 are very capable of wearing lenses successfully! And kids seeing other kids that are successful with contact lenses goes a long way.

Defocus Media: Myth Busting Astigmatism Contact Lenses

the numbers show that there is a definite lag between the number of Americans that have astigmatism and those that wear astigmatism contact lenses. On average 45% of Americans have 0.75 DC or more, but toric contact lenses represent only 27% of soft contact lenses prescribed in the USA.
